Description:
-
Studies legal ethics and the nonlawyer professional's role in a law office, corporate or public interest legal department, or government agency. Explores nature, scope and ethics of legal practice and the relationship of nonlawyer staff to lawyers, clients, the court system and the public. Legal practice in Alaska and the rules governing the unauthorized practice of law are emphasized. Foundational practice skills and principles of legal research and writing are introduced. Emphasizes professional skills development. Legal specialty course.
